So, Lucky Luke: The Ballad of the Daltons is a quirky animated flick from '78, directed by Pierre Watrin. It captures that playful spirit of the comics, blending humor and a bit of Western flair. The Dalton brothers, in their silly schemes, are actually quite entertaining, and it’s intriguing to see how they navigate their greed. The animation has this distinct style that feels both nostalgic and lively, even if it’s not the most polished work of the era. The pacing has that classic '70s vibe, where it takes its time, allowing the comedic moments to breathe. If you're into family-oriented films with that mix of comedy and a hint of adventure, this one definitely has its charm.
